mats original rib cat achieved 120 mph i think ,he took me out in it when i went to sweden to repair the tubes and we got up to 96mph before it porpoised under the water and back up again and the mad f....... just kept going .it was fitted with an 8.5 ltr ,850 horse power engine i think ,photos are on my wesite www.tidel.biz .the original tubes had to be reshaped at the stern as the spray of water was cutting through the tubes .most uncomfortable boat ive ever been in ,grp rally car seat no padding glassed to 3x2 timbers that were glassed to the hull ,slightly hard ride
